An estimate of 93.99 percent of the residents in 33620 has some form of health insurance. 3.29 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 91.42 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 33620 would have to travel an average of 0.90 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Tampa Va Medical Center. In a 20-mile radius, there are 39,809 healthcare providers accessible to residents living in 33620, Tampa, Florida.
